Skip to content

Vizel API / svelte/src / CreateVizelMarkdownResult

Interface: CreateVizelMarkdownResult

Defined in: packages/svelte/src/runes/createVizelMarkdown.svelte.ts:18

Properties

current

ts
readonly current: string;

Defined in: packages/svelte/src/runes/createVizelMarkdown.svelte.ts:23

Current markdown content (reactive getter). Updates with debounce when editor content changes.


flush

ts
flush: () => void;

Defined in: packages/svelte/src/runes/createVizelMarkdown.svelte.ts:36

Force immediate export (flush pending debounced export).

Returns

void


isPending

ts
readonly isPending: boolean;

Defined in: packages/svelte/src/runes/createVizelMarkdown.svelte.ts:32

Whether markdown export is currently pending (debounced).


setMarkdown

ts
setMarkdown: (markdown) => void;

Defined in: packages/svelte/src/runes/createVizelMarkdown.svelte.ts:28

Set markdown content to the editor. Automatically transforms diagram code blocks if transformDiagrams is enabled.

Parameters

ParameterType
markdownstring

Returns

void

Released under the MIT License.